jQuery使用动画队列自定义动画操作示例

网络编程 2025-03-24 00:08www.168986.cn编程入门

这篇文章了如何使用jQuery通过动画队列进行自定义动画操作。让我们一同领略这一令人惊叹的技术,了解如何通过queue()和dequeue()方法实现函数队列的操作。

让我们理解这两个方法的工作原理。想象一下,你有一系列的动画函数,它们需要按照一定的顺序执行。你可以通过queue()方法将这些函数加入到一个队列中。然后,当你想要开始执行这些函数时,你可以使用dequeue()方法取出队列中的第一个函数并执行它。一旦这个函数执行完毕,下一个函数就会自动开始执行。这样,你就可以创建出复杂的动画序列,每个动画都能无缝地衔接在一起。

下面是一个简单的示例。当用户点击一个元素时,一个面板首先会向上滑动,然后逐渐变亮。这两个动作是通过两个函数实现的,它们被放入一个数组中,并通过queue()方法加入到jQuery的动画队列中。然后,我们定义了一个事件处理程序,该程序的功能是从函数队列最前端移除一个队列函数,并获取队列中的下一个函数执行。我们执行这个事件处理程序,开始播放动画。

这段代码使用了HTML、CSS和JavaScript的混合编程技术。样式方面,面板和翻转元素都有相应的CSS样式定义,使得它们在网页上呈现出特定的外观。通过JavaScript代码实现了点击事件和动画效果。

这个示例展示了如何使用jQuery的动画队列功能来创建自定义的动画效果。通过这种方式,你可以创造出几乎无限数量的动画组合,让你的网页充满动感和活力。无论是对于一个简单的网站还是一个复杂的应用程序,这种技术都能带来令人惊叹的视觉效果。

如果你对jQuery的其它方面感兴趣,例如选择器、事件处理、插件开发等,我们也有许多相关的文章和教程供你学习。我们希望这篇文章能帮助你更好地理解如何使用jQuery的动画队列功能,并在你的项目中应用这项技术。如果你有任何问题或需要进一步的帮助,请随时向我们提问。让我们一起学习,一起进步!

Copyright © 2016-2025 www.168986.cn 狼蚁网络 版权所有 Power by